Air Express International, Inc. v. United States
21 Cust. Ct. 255, 1948 Cust. Ct. LEXIS 812
CourtUnited States Customs Court
DecidedDecember 9, 1948
DocketNo. 52727; protest 138925-K (Los Angeles)
StatusPublished

Opinion
Opinion by
An examination of the record failing to disclose evidence to overcome the presumption of correctness attaching to the collector’s decision, the protest was overruled.
